Phyla of kingdom Animalia
Explain the nine phyla of kingdom Animalia?
Expert
The nine phyla of animal kingdom are: Porifera (or poriferans), Cnidaria (or cnidarians), Platyhelminthes (or flatworms), Echinodermata (or echinoderms) Nematoda (or roundworms), Mollusca (or molluscs), Annelida (or annelids), Arthropoda (or arthropods), and Chordata (or chordates).
